7 Rules of Using Radio Buttons vs Drop-Down Menus by Saadia Minhas Prototypr

0

Buttons or Dropdowns in FrontEnd Development

Optimize Dropdowns for your brand, custom theming options, and accessibility best practices. Create captivating user experiences and enhance brand persona with design adventure. Explore a diverse collection of cool icons, powerful UI kits, and tools, along with a fascinating history of user interfaces on today’s list.

Buttons or Dropdowns in FrontEnd Development

Social Media Buttons

Optimized for building complex data-dense interfaces for desktop and mobile applications. Improve UX and navigation efficiency with a well-designed filter system for complex data sets and product catalogs. Learn the secrets to enhanced user satisfaction in UI design.

Options

Buttons or Dropdowns in FrontEnd Development

They also enhance collaboration by enabling multiple developers to work on the same codebase simultaneously while minimizing conflicts through structured merge processes. Leveraging Content Delivery Networks (CDNs) helps distribute assets globally, reducing physical distances to servers and speeding up rendering times. Implementing lazy loading delays the loading of resources until they are needed, further improving initial load times and conserving bandwidth. Frontend development comes with its own set of challenges, from managing slow page load times to handling CSS specificity conflicts and enhancing security. Prototyping involves creating interactive, clickable models that simulate the user journey. This stage allows for valuable feedback and iterative improvements, ensuring the final product is both functional and user-friendly.

  • ✍ Clearly indicate the selected option, either through text, visual styling, or both, to avoid confusion and provide clarity to the user.
  • Authors will have to include these more specific attributes themselves.
  • When we mention Airbnb, there’s a lot of great takeaways from their website.
  • To handle these conflicts, developers should use a consistent naming convention and avoid using !
  • It’s clever design that gets users where they need to be faster and with much less effort.
  • Put down that JavaScript and check out these new and upcoming features coming to HTML and CSS.

What is frontend development?

Ryanair got that balance right, giving users the option to choose the location of their flight from a list of options in a dropdown. It’s true that the learning curve for programs like Photoshop is big, but given the sheer number of buttons designers need, the UI design actually does a great job. Designers can learn their way around the different dropdown menus, which are well-organized and become easy to remember over time.

Excalidraw is an open-source, online whiteboard for sketching diagrams and layouts. Its hand-drawn style and intuitive tools make it perfect for brainstorming, flowcharting, or quickly mapping out ideas for web projects. SVG repo is a popular free site for finding and using SVG vectors, they have a collection of over 500,000 icons and vectors for you to choose from. All the icons are available for free for both personal and commercial projects. “the written once-and-forgotten code” thing, now go and copy the code. Button examples with style options utilizing base64 encoding for pseudo element imagery.

SVG Play Buttons

This involves combining the visibility and opacity properties together to get the desired result. In this guide, you’ll learn how to build a dropdown navigation menu using HTML, CSS, and JavaScript. The general menu that the dropdown exposes is well-organized, with dropdowns used within the menu itself using the ‘plus’ sign. The result is a menu that offers many different options, but conveys a good hierarchy in the options, resulting in a menu that users can easily understand. Alex Muench designed this wonderful example of a dropdown that is oriented towards help and feedback for Doist.

Apple

Think about how many times you’ve been on a website or in a web app and the menu accidentally opened because you hovered your mouse too close to it. Explore the many styles of React dropdowns, how you can use them in your own code, and even some real examples. Add a header to label sections of actions in any dropdown menu. By default, a dropdown menu is automatically positioned 100% from the top and along the left side of its parent. Add .dropdown-menu-right to a .dropdown-menu to right align the dropdown menu.

Explore the benefits, features, and best practices Buttons or Dropdowns in FrontEnd Development of SaaS dashboards to enhance your business’s data-driven decision-making. I’ll never forget the first time a web design client refused to pay for my work – here’s what I learned from the experience. We explore the benefits and drawbacks of this design feature and how it can impact your workflow and design quality. Extensive tutorial how to design a pricing section that drives sales and conversions. If you noticed, we added a stopPropagation() method inside the dropdown function. This prevents the function of the button element from being passed down to the parent element, thus stopping the function from running twice.

Leave a reply

Please enter your comment!
Please enter your name here